Headword: *parako/yas
Adler number: pi,370
Translated headword: having gone mad
Vetting Status: high
Translation:
[Meaning] having lost his mind. "He died, full of lots of unmixed wine and having gone mad, at the age of seventy-five".[1]
Greek Original:
*parako/yas: to\n nou=n trapei/s. e)teleu/thse de/, a)/kraton polu\n e)mforhqei\s kai\ parako/yas, h)/dh gegonw\s e)/tos pe/mpton kai\ e(bdomhkosto/n.
Notes:
The headword, presumably extracted from the quotation given, is the aorist participle (used intransitively) of the verb parako/ptw. See the related noun parakoph/ at pi 369.
[1] Diogenes Laertius 4.44 (citing Hermippus) on the early-Hellenistic philosopher Arcesilaus (alpha 3950).
